Collection Host Volunteer Edinburgh, East and West Lothian
Job Summary
Be the heart of the action the organiser behind our community collections and become a Collection Host.
Youll be the friendly face that keeps everything running smoothly at busy locations like supermarkets train stations high streets and shopping centres. Youll support our volunteer collectors inspire generosity from the public and help raise vital funds for Marie Curie services.
Availability: 4 hours - at various points of the year
Time: Flexible to suit your schedule
Locations:Edinburgh
Criteria: Aged 18 or over
What youll do:
- Be present on-site during collection days
- Welcome volunteers help them feel confident and ready
- Keep things organised and positive
- Encourage public support and kindness
- Help recruit new collectors
- Thank volunteers secure donations and assist with banking
Why youd be a great fit:
- Bring a positive attitude a smile and great people skills
- Organisational flair and team spirit
- A passion for helping others
- Bonus points: you know the best spots in town!
What youll receive and achieve:
- Essential training ongoing guidance and wellbeing support
- Recognition for your time and effort
- Updates on the difference youre making
- Long Service Awards
- Be part of the UKs leading end-of-life charity
- Travel and expenses covered
- Access to discounts on shopping travel entertainment and more
